FINRA (Financial Industry Regulatory Authority) is the largest independent regulator of securities firms doing business in the United States. Our mission is to protect investors and ensure market integrity through effective and efficient regulation. We oversee approximately 3,400 brokerage firms, 152,000 branch offices, and nearly 624,000 registered securities representatives.
